Damage of Bridges in 2008 Wenchuan China Earthquake
This is a reconnaissance report on damage of bridges during the 2008 Wenchuan, China earthquake. Site investigation was conducted by the authors on August 10-14, 2008. Presented is damage of twelve bridges as well as discussion on possible damage mechanism. Characteristics of two near-field ground accelerations and Chinese practice on seismic design of bridges are also presented. It is found from the damage investigation that insufficient intensity of seismic design force, inadequate structural detailing for enhancing the ductility capacity and absence of unseating prevention devices resulted in the destructive damage of bridges.
